When we think about sports, the first thing that comes to mind is physical fitness. Engaging in sports helps improve cardiovascular health, muscle strength, and endurance. Regular participation in activities like running, swimming, or cycling builds stamina and improves overall physical health. The combination of strength training, flexibility exercises, and aerobic movements involved in sports leads to a toned body and better posture. The mental health benefits of sports are just as important as the physical ones. Physical activity stimulates the release of endorphins, also known as "feel-good" hormones, which can help reduce symptoms of depression and anxiety. Sports provide an opportunity to escape the stress of daily life, offering a sense of achievement, joy, and mental relaxation. Whether it’s through team sports or individual activities, engaging in sports improves mental clarity, focus, and overall emotional stability. Sports serve as an effective stress-reliever. Physical activity allows individuals to focus on the task at hand, leaving behind any worries or frustrations. The release of endorphins during exercise reduces stress levels, helping the body relax. Sports such as yoga, swimming, or even a light jog can help release tension in muscles, leading to a calm and peaceful mind. By regularly engaging in physical activities, you can manage stress effectively and develop coping mechanisms for tough situations. People who regularly engage in sports often report improved sleep quality. Physical activity helps regulate the body’s internal clock, making it easier to fall asleep and stay asleep throughout the night. Exercise increases the time spent in deep sleep, which is essential for the body to recover and heal. Sports like running, cycling, or even a morning workout routine contribute to better sleep patterns, allowing you to wake up feeling refreshed and energized. If you struggle with sleep issues, incorporating sports into your routine may provide a natural solution. Regular participation in sports strengthens the immune system by improving circulation and boosting the production of white blood cells. These cells are crucial for fighting off infections and maintaining a healthy immune response. Moderate physical activity, such as playing a sport a few times a week, enhances your body’s ability to defend itself against viruses and bacteria. One of the most enjoyable aspects of sports is the sense of community they create. Team sports, in particular, provide an excellent opportunity to connect with others, form friendships, and work together toward common goals. These social interactions are crucial for mental health as they reduce feelings of loneliness and isolation. The bonds formed in sports create a support system, and learning how to cooperate with others helps develop valuable teamwork skills that can be applied to both personal and professional life. Sports aren’t just good for the body; they’re also great for the brain. Regular exercise increases blood flow to the brain, which supports cognitive function and memory. Research has shown that physical activity boosts brain health by promoting neurogenesis, the process of creating new neurons. Playing sports also enhances concentration, decision-making skills, and reaction times. This mental agility can be beneficial in all aspects of life, from work to personal tasks. Engaging in sports, therefore, is an excellent way to sharpen your mind while improving your overall health. Sports are a fun and effective way to maintain or achieve a healthy weight. Regular physical activity burns calories, builds muscle, and increases metabolism. By participating in sports, you can achieve a balanced body weight while improving overall health. Whether you're playing tennis, basketball, or hiking, the variety of sports available makes it easier to find activities that you enjoy, helping you stay consistent in your fitness journey. Managing weight is an essential aspect of both physical and mental health, and sports play a significant role in this process.
Finally, the long-term health benefits of sports cannot be overstated. Engaging in regular physical activity helps prevent chronic diseases such as heart disease, diabetes, and obesity. It also improves longevity by lowering the risk of developing age-related illnesses. Starting a sports routine early in life can significantly reduce the chances of major health problems later on.
